Morang farmers get above-government support price for spring paddy
Belbari, June 26 -- Farmers in Morang are receiving more than the government-set minimum support price for this season's spring paddy after a private rice mill offered a higher procurement rate, giving growers better returns as they harvest the crop.
Arju Rice Mill, based in Dangihat of Belbari Municipality-9, has fixed its procurement price for spring paddy at Rs28.97 per kilogramme, 39 paisa higher than the government's recently announced minimum support price of Rs28.58 per kilogramme for paddy with 25 percent moisture content.
The move has been welcomed by farmers, who say better prices have boosted their confidence despite persistent concerns over market stability and government procurement.
